Pedagogical and didactic training for fp uned teachers
Pedagogical and didactic training is a discipline that is responsible for the training of teachers at the university level. It focuses on the study of teaching and learning as well as the practice of teaching. Pedagogical and didactic training has as its main objective to improve the quality of teaching in universities, and thus contribute to the development of higher education.
At present, pedagogical and didactic training is constantly evolving, and is adapting to the new needs of higher education. One of the areas in which more attention is being paid in recent years is the training of vocational training teachers.
The training of vocational training teachers is an area of pedagogical and didactic training that is being developed very intensively at the National Distance Education University (UNED). UNED is one of the most important universities in Spain, and offers quality training to teachers from all over the country.
The training of vocational training teachers at UNED is carried out through a series of specific training programmes, which are designed to cover the training needs of this group. The training programs are aimed at teachers who teach in professional training centers, and are aimed at improving the quality of teaching in these centers.
The training programs for vocational training teachers at UNED are characterized by being very complete, and by offering quality training. They are designed so that teachers acquire the necessary skills to teach effectively in vocational training centers, and so that they can actively contribute to the development of vocational training in Spain.

What is Cofpyd?
The Confederation of Women's Organizations of Paraguay (COFOPY) is a non-governmental and non-profit organization, founded on March 8, 1988, which brings together women and girls from all over the national territory. It is the representative entity of grassroots women's organizations in Paraguay, and its fundamental objective is the achievement of equal rights and opportunities between women and men, in order to contribute to the construction of a more just and inclusive society.
COFOPY is made up of five departments: Department of Institutional Management, Department of Communication and Training, Department of Research and Analysis, Department of International Cooperation and Department of Legal Affairs.
COFOPY has a team of professionals and technicians specialized in gender and human rights issues, who accompany and advise women's organizations in the field of training, investigation, analysis, monitoring and reporting of violations of rights, as well as in the elaboration and execution of plans and projects.
COFOPY is affiliated with the Latin American and Caribbean Confederation of Women (CLACDM), the International Federation of Progressive Women (FIAP) and the World Association of Women (AWID).
